The Mechanics of Randomness: How RNGs Work

At its core, an RNG is a complex algorithm designed to produce sequences of numbers that appear statistically random. This randomness is the cornerstone of fair play in online casino games. The algorithms used can vary, but the fundamental principle remains the same: to generate unpredictable outcomes. These algorithms are typically based on mathematical formulas that use a “seed” value as a starting point. This seed can be derived from various sources, such as the system clock, user input, or even environmental factors. The algorithm then processes this seed through a series of mathematical operations to produce a sequence of numbers. The quality of an RNG is determined by its statistical properties. A good RNG must pass rigorous tests to ensure that the generated numbers are truly random and unpredictable. These tests include checks for uniformity, independence, and lack of patterns. The output of the RNG is then mapped to the game’s outcome. For example, in a slot game, the RNG might generate a number that corresponds to a specific symbol on each reel. In a card game, the RNG would determine the order of the cards in the deck. The entire process, from seed generation to outcome determination, must be audited and verified by independent testing laboratories to ensure fairness and compliance with regulatory standards.

Types of RNGs: Pseudo-Random vs. True Random

There are two primary types of RNGs: pseudo-random number generators (PRNGs) and true random number generators (TRNGs). PRNGs are the most commonly used type in online casino games. They are deterministic algorithms that generate sequences of numbers based on a seed value. While these sequences appear random, they are, in fact, predictable if the algorithm and seed are known. However, the complexity of modern PRNGs makes them sufficiently unpredictable for practical purposes. TRNGs, on the other hand, generate random numbers based on physical phenomena, such as thermal noise or radioactive decay. These are considered to be truly random, as their output is not based on a deterministic algorithm. While TRNGs offer a higher degree of randomness, they are more complex and expensive to implement. The choice between PRNGs and TRNGs often depends on the specific requirements of the game and the level of security required. In the Irish market, regulatory bodies typically require that all RNGs, regardless of type, are independently tested and certified to ensure fairness and compliance.

The Role of Independent Testing and Certification

The integrity of online casino games is not solely dependent on the RNG itself; it’s also reliant on the rigorous testing and certification processes conducted by independent laboratories. These laboratories, such as eCOGRA, GLI, and iTech Labs, play a crucial role in verifying the fairness and randomness of RNGs. They conduct a variety of tests to assess the statistical properties of the generated numbers, ensuring that they meet the required standards. These tests include checks for uniformity, independence, and lack of patterns. In addition to testing the RNG, these laboratories also evaluate the overall game design, including the payout percentages (Return to Player or RTP), to ensure that they align with the advertised values. The certification process involves a thorough review of the game’s code, algorithms, and documentation. Once a game has passed all the necessary tests, the laboratory issues a certificate, which provides assurance to players and regulators that the game is fair and compliant. This certification is a critical component of building trust and credibility in the Irish online casino market. The presence of reputable certification marks on a game is a strong indicator of its integrity and fairness.

Impact on Game Design and Player Experience

RNG technology has a profound impact on both game design and the overall player experience. The randomness generated by the RNG is what drives the unpredictable outcomes that make casino games engaging and exciting. Game developers must carefully consider the properties of the RNG when designing their games. They need to ensure that the RNG is capable of generating the required range of numbers and that the game mechanics are designed to leverage the randomness effectively. The RTP of a game, which is the percentage of wagered money that the game is expected to pay back to players over time, is also heavily influenced by the RNG. The game developer must carefully calculate the RTP based on the probabilities generated by the RNG. The player experience is also directly impacted by the RNG. Players rely on the fairness and randomness of the games to ensure that they have a fair chance of winning. The perception of fairness is a critical factor in player satisfaction and retention. Therefore, online casinos must prioritize the use of certified RNGs and transparent game designs to build trust and maintain a positive player experience. Furthermore, the speed and efficiency of the RNG are also important. The RNG must be able to generate numbers quickly and reliably to ensure a smooth and seamless gaming experience.
